CLEANING AND MAINTENANCE

Proper routine maintenance and cleaning
of the appliance can significantly extend its
trouble-free operation.
Before cleaning or other mainte-
nance work, always unplug the
appliance or use the main electri-
cal system circuit breaker to cut off
power. Do not begin cleaning until
the hob has cooled. Do not use
abrasive scouring powders.
Do not use steam cleaning equip-
ment for cleaning.
Burners, hob grid
If the burners and grid become soiled,
remove them from the hob and wash in
warm water with some dishwashing liquid.
Wipe dry. Once the grid is removed, thor-
oughly clean the area under the burner
and wipe it dry with a soft cloth. Flame
outlets and burner head must be clean at
all times, see figure below. Clean the gas
nozzles using a thin copper wire. Do not
use steel wire or ream the holes.
All burner parts must be always
dry. Water droplets may block the
gas flow and cause the burner to
operate incorrectly.
Make sure that burner is correctly re-
assembled after cleaning.

Use mild detergents to wash enamel
surfaces. When cleaning do not use abra-
sive cleaners such as scouring powders,
pastes, abrasive stones, pumice, metal
scrubbers, etc.
Thoroughly clean the stainless steel
hob before use. Especially make sure
to remove any adhesive residue or self-
adhesive tape applied when the appli-
ance was packaged.
Clean the hob after each use. Do not
allow the hob to get heavily stained;
particularly from burnt–on spillages from
boiled over liquids.
